A man in his 20s was stabbed after a fight broke out between 10 people in March at the weekend.

Police were called at 2.20am on Sunday (July 8) with reports of a fight in High Street.

A police spokesman said: “It was reported a group of about 10 people, mainly men, were fighting, and one person had been stabbed.

“The victim, a man in his 20s, was taken to Peterborough City Hospital by ambulance.

His injuries were not deemed to be life-threatening.”
